About The Position

The Intern, United States (U.S.) Property Tax is responsible for assisting the Manager, U.S. Property Taxes with updating property tax assessments and payments on U.S. assets. The incumbent contributes occasionally to the review of state-assessed property valuations. Additionally, the role performs miscellaneous tasks, including other types of tax compliance as needed.

Responsibilities

  • Pay property taxes to various authorities
  • Assist with compiling annual property tax filings
  • Review annual assessment notices and update internal records that rely on this information
  • Perform clerical tasks associated with property tax payment processes
  • Carry out other tasks as needed
